
Chateau Jean Faux Bordeaux Superieur 2015 92pts
Located in the small commune of Sainte Radegonde, former wine barrel cooper, Pascal Collotte knows a thing or two about "hand craft" and attention to detail. That's why it took him years to find the perfect property in 2002 at Chateau Jean Faux. The park like setting of the property is an estate with a lot of history dating back to the 18th century. Pascal does everything right at his property, from organic farming, green harvest and manual harvest in crates.Cement and stainless steel tanks , cold prefermentation maceration. Aged for 12 to 14 months in 100% French oak, 50% new.
80% Merlot, 20% Cabernet Franc
92 Points James Suckling
Intense aromas of blackberries, lavender and black tea. Bark, too. Full body, round and soft tannins and a delicious aftertaste. Drink now.

The 2015 Jean Faux wraps around the palate with notable depth and intensity. Silky, sumptuous and forward, the 2015 offers striking intensity to match its unctuous, inviting personality. Succulent black cherry, plum, violets, mint and lavender add the closing shades of nuance- Vinous, Antonio Galloni.
